What's there to see in Knoxville?
If you're looking for some ways to explore Knoxville while making the most of your travel budget, this destination has lots to offer. Spots where you'll find natural beauty on display include World's Fair Park, Knoxville Botanical Garden and Arboretum and Ijams Nature Center. Other places not to be missed include Bijou Theater, Tennessee Theatre and Market Square.
